Operating conditions:

-

-

-

... More
1) To operate the softeners to the operating conditions i.e., to maintain water hardness 0 to 2 ppm. If, hardness of feed water is more than 2 ppm, immediately regenerate the resin. 2) To operate the steam boilers to supply the steam without affecting the cooking system during all working hours duly in contact with the cooking staff. Daily to check up the PPM levels of the water, if necessary chemical will be supplied by the contractor for checking the PPM.

-

-

-

... More
3) To supply steam to hot water generation and to supply the hot water as per the requirement duly in contact with the canteen staff. 4) To receive the diesel supplied by the Department into the barrels and to feed to the diesel tanks according to the requirement and to maintain diesel barrels.

-

-

-

... More
5) To maintain diesel / LPG, water levels and different valves to the operating conditions. 6) Checking of the different valves daily. 7) Maintaining the inlet pressure according to the requirements. 8) To maintain daily log sheets showing particulars of running of the boilers and obtaining the signature from the concern user department. 9) To maintain the register for water hardness 10) To maintain the blow-down check & quantity of water circulation regularly and maintain the register. 11) To clean the boilers and its premises daily.

-

-

-

... More
The Boiler operators should follow the Boiler operating Manuals as follows: (A) Before starting the boiler, should follow the below instructions: 1. Check water quality so as the hardness of water is within 2 ppm. Check the hardness of feed water after four hours of operation. If, hardness of feed water is more than 2ppm, immediately regenerate the resin. 2. Check that the soft water tanks and fuel oil service tanks are in full. 3. Open fuel oil inlet valve. 4. Put 'ON' electric main switch. 5. Close the main stop valve and open the by-pass vale.

-

-

-

... More
6. Open the feed water inlet valve. 7. Check that the blow-down valve is fully closed. 8. Check and ensure that the temperature indicator-cum-controller setting is not altered. 9. Observe steam escaping to drain through the by-pass valve. 10. Now gradually open the main stop valve and close the by-pass valve. 11. To check the pressure, temperature, water levels by help of gauges. 12. Maintain LOG book of every boiler.

-

-

-

... More
B) Before stopping the boiler, should follow the instructions: 1. Close the steam valve. The pressure switch/temperature controller will cut off the boiler. 2. Close the water inlet valve. 3. Open the blow-down valve and blow-down the boiler. 4. Open the economizer blow-down valve. 5. Now, close the blow-down valve and open the by-pass valve. 6. Fully open the water inlet valve. 7. Put the rotary switch 'ON' and start the feed water pump and circulate cold water till temperature comes down to 40 degree's. 8. Close the water inlet valve and fuel oil inlet valve. 9. Fill the fuel oil service tank for nest day's operation. 10. Put 'OFF' the electric main switch. 11. Clean the boiler, its top and surroundings for nay dripped oil etc., 12. To cut off fuel inlet valve and check up once again total unit.

II DAILY MAINTANANCE & SERVICING

-

-

-

... More
A) The agency should carry out the following works: 1) Arresting leakages of steam lines, cold/hot water lines and diesel lines/ LPG lines etc., 2) Removing, cleaning & resetting of filters, strainers, burner rod assembly, economizer, water pump, diesel pump, optimizer, General check up of electrical item to ensure all safeties. 3) All the spares rewinding/replacement of motors, electrical spare parts (excluding steam boiler coils & Inner jackets) required should be replaced immediately without affecting the smooth running of the system. 4) If necessary, steam boiler coils & Inner jackets will be provided by the Departments. 5) All the spare parts whatsoever required should be of approved make & quality which are same to that as existence and as directed by the department. 6) Any welding works/lathe works should be attended immediately without hampering the smooth running of the systems.

-

-

-

... More
B) The firm should also carry out monthly one time servicing for all the boilers. During servicing of the boilers, the following works shall be carried out i.e., cleaning of filters, strainers, burner rod assembly, economizer, optimizer, valves & all accessories, general check up of electrical items to ensure all safeties and keeping the boilers in good working condition including replacing of soared parts if necessary like gland washers, oil seals, valve seat assembly, hydraulic hose, photo cell, belt, side glasses, ignition cable, pickings, arresting leakages etc., complete. The firm would also carryout test to ensure that the unit performs at the rated efficiency levels, there by results in optimum fuel consumption.

-

-

-

... More
C) The firm should carry out servicing for all the water softner once in every six months for re-charging of resin or as directed by the department. 1) To remove fronties pipe lines, distributors and resin. 2) To recharge the resin by soaking for -4 hours with " Resin charging compound (UC - 666 Unit Charge): to remove contamination in the resin and to make the resin for more effective. 3) To top-up the resin of 15% to 20% with Thermax / Catton - 220 an+ after recharging of the process due to the loss of resin while doing the recharging. 4) To re-fix the frontier pipe lines, distributors and refill the resin. 5) The firm should ensure that the unit performs at the rated efficiency levels.

-

-

-

... More
D) Descaling of the Boilers: The firm should carryout descaling whenever scale formation of the coil occurs with the following specification to ensure that the unit performance at the rated efficiency levels, there by results in optimum fuel consumption. 1) Temporary connections are to be given duly using a separate water pump. 2) Approved de-scaling compound should be used and de-scaling should be done till the scales are removed fully.

-

-

-

... More
3) After de-scaling caustic soda / caustic potash solution is to be used to neutralize any acidic traces in the coil. The necessary chemicals are supplied by the contractor. 4) Finally the temporary connections are to be disconnected and the boilers is to be connected to the permanent piping, tanks and the boilers should be decommissioned to work at the rated efficiency levels. 5) a) The contractor/ firm should invariable do the descaling of the boilers at regular intervals to maintain the boilers in good condition the record in this regard should be maintained properly. b) The contractor/ firm should procure the required pump sets and other required materials for the process of descaling and should be kept in the site. c) During the descaling process of the one boiler the other boiler should be maintain in good working condition and kept in operation to supply the steam to the user department without any interruption.

-

-

-

... More
E) Blow down time should be always less than 30 seconds. IF found it is more than 30 seconds a fine of Rs.10,000/- will be levied in addition to the penalty clause. The daily blow down record should be maintained properly.

-

-

-

... More
F) The firm should carry out overhauling of steam boilers as per necessity including repairing / replacement of coil with the following specification. (If necessary, steam boiler coils & inner jackets will be provided by the Department) During the overhauling of the boiler, the firm should dismantle the unit, take out the coil unit, cleaning of coil (externally) / changing of coil (if necessary, new steam coils / inner jackets will be supplied by the department), casting of bottom refractory and top if necessary, changing of gaskets & other accessories, welding, repairing work including labou, checking of electrical items, restoring and checking the performance of the unit. The firm would also carry out test to ensure that the unit performs at the rated efficiency levels, there by attaining optimum fuel consumption etc., complete as directed during execution.

GENERAL CONDITIONS FOR BOILERS:

-

-

-

... More
1) The firm should ensure that the unit performs at the rated efficiency levels to attain optimum fuel consumption. 2) Any steam/hot water leakages should be attended immediately, failing which suitable fine will be imposed for the energy losses. 3) Any break down of the boiler systems/water softners/hot water, systems, should be rectified within 24 hours. Failure in this regard, leads to imposing of stringent fines. 4) For any mis-handling/negligence in operation of machinery suitable fine will be imposed duly recovering the losses caused to machinery. 5) For authorized operating personnel should invariably present at the boilers round the clock. 6) No person should work more than 8 hours in a day at any where. 7) At the end of the contract the contractor must do the servicing of the equipment and to handling over the equipments to the department at TACT & Good condition.

-

-

-

... More
8) The machinery log should be maintained and record the working times & breakdown periods of each and every machine at each section and should be presented for inspection of the Department. 9) The personnel engaged should be experienced and of sound health. The agency should be always in contact with the Engineer-in-charge regarding running of the machinery. The firm should maintain all the records and to produce the same as directed by the Department.
